Banking Technology Architecture Lead – NAM
The Banking Technology Architecture Lead – NAM is a senior strategic position responsible for bridging distributed engineering teams and enterprise architecture strategy across the North America region. Operating within the Banking Technology organization, this role drives measurable delivery improvement through platform adoption, impediment resolution, and AI-first methodologies. The overall objective is to accelerate engineering delivery velocity by embedding architectural best practices and intelligent, data-driven decision-making at the team level — with AI serving as the primary force multiplier for regional impact.

Key Responsibilities
Regional Architecture Adoption
- Drive measurable adoption of Citi Manifesto principles, Golden Paths, and Foundational platforms across NAM engineering teams.
- Translate enterprise architecture vision into practical, actionable guidance that accelerates delivery velocity.
- Achieve quantifiable adoption metrics through hands-on enablement and demonstration of platform value.
- Leverage AI-powered analytics to identify adoption patterns, surface friction points, and personalize enablement strategies for different team contexts and maturity levels.
- Build trusted relationships with engineering team leads by acting as a visible, accessible partner — not an oversight function — to encourage voluntary adoption of architectural standards.
Engineering Impediments & Lead Time Improvement
- Systematically collect, document, and analyze real engineering bottlenecks and recurring delivery obstacles using AI-driven analysis across incident reports, delivery metrics, and workflow telemetry.
- Deploy AI-powered delivery analytics tools to identify lead time bottlenecks across the full software delivery lifecycle — spanning planning, development, testing, and deployment.
- Champion an AI-first approach to continuous improvement, ensuring all recommendations are grounded in data and augmented by intelligent tooling rather than anecdotal observation.
Architecture Function Communication & Governance
- Maintain reliable, cadenced communication with the Head of Architecture (weekly/bi-weekly), providing structured updates on impediments, adoption progress, and improvement outcomes.
- Manage enterprise architecture processes to ensure they enhance — rather than hinder — delivery velocity.
- Provide data-driven evidence of lead time improvements attributable to architecture initiatives, using AI-generated insights and delivery dashboards where applicable.
- Ensure AI tools and analytics platforms adopted within the architecture function comply with enterprise AI governance standards, including explainability, fairness, and data privacy requirements — collaborating with risk, legal, and compliance teams as needed.

Qualifications
Must-Have Skills & Experience
- 8+ years in software engineering, platform engineering, or enterprise architecture roles, with 3+ years in a senior or lead capacity.
- Demonstrated experience driving platform or tooling adoption across distributed engineering teams.
- Proven AI-first mindset: hands-on, day-to-day experience using AI tools, analytics platforms, or LLM-based solutions to improve engineering workflows, delivery metrics, or decision-making — this is a non-negotiable requirement.
- Strong analytical skills with the ability to translate delivery telemetry and impediment data into actionable architectural recommendations.
- Familiarity with DORA metrics and software delivery lifecycle performance frameworks (lead time, cycle time, deployment frequency, change failure rate).
- Experience working across cross-functional teams including DevOps, platform engineering, and developer experience functions.
- Excellent communication and stakeholder management skills, with a demonstrated ability to influence without direct authority — essential given the embedded liaison operating model.
